Traditional pub in the heart of Heptonstall - our room looking out onto the high street had big windows, a nice view down the street & character. The bar and dining area were relaxed and the atmosphere easy going. Was a nice surprise to find they offered six guest beers that regularly change.

The rooms are above a pub so you can’t expect total peace & quiet, in some rooms at least , but I think most people would figure that out before booking :-)

The room was comfortable and clean. The staff were incredible, nothing was a problem. It is set in the centre of a beautiful, historic village with easy access to Hebden Bridge and surrounding areas. Although there is no onsite parking there is a nearby public car park. Access available at all times.

Not really suitable for disabled people.
